Comfort Yeboah joins Spanish side DUX Logrono

Ghana women’s national team defender Comfort Yeboah has made a step forward in her career following a move to Spanish club DUX Logrono.

The right-back makes the move to the European nation after a glittering career with Ghana based Ampem Darkoa Ladies last campaign. She signs a deal to feature for the side in the 2025/26 season.

The 18-year-old becomes the second Ghanaian player to join Logrono in the transfer window, following former teammate Nancy Amoh. A statement by the club about the capture of Comfort Yeboah read:

“Welcome to DUX Logrono, Comfort Yeboah. Together, we will work hard and fight to achieve great sporting successes. Your talent and dedication will bring a very valuable reinforcement to our club. We look forward to seeing you shine on the field and celebrating many victories together!”

Yeboah played a pivotal role in Ghana’s campaign at the Women’s Africa Cup of Nations in Morocco where the Black Queens claimed bronze in July.

She was also a pivotal member of the Ampem Darkoa Ladies team that dominated the National Women’s League and also participated at the WAFU Women Champions League.
